Core Mechanics and Gameplay Impact
The primary function of this mod is to provide a low-tier harvesting tool crafted exclusively from wooden planks. In the unmodified game, acquiring shears requires a significant investment of time and resources, including mining, smelting, and crafting. By contrast, this modification enables players to create functional shears within the first few minutes of gameplay. These wooden variants possess a durability of 50 uses, making them ideal for temporary tasks such as clearing foliage for building materials or collecting string for beds and looms before proper armor and weapons are forged.
This mechanic is particularly valuable in hardcore modes or on servers with modified economy settings where iron is scarce during the opening hours. It allows players to prioritize iron for critical equipment like shields, buckets, and pickaxes while still accessing shear-dependent mechanics. The tool interacts with all standard blocks and entities that vanilla shears affect, ensuring full compatibility with existing farming strategies and decorative projects.

Configuration and Server Balancing
Balance is a critical consideration for any survival enhancement. Out of the box, the wooden shears are configured with limited durability to prevent them from becoming a permanent replacement for iron tools. However, the mod includes comprehensive configuration files that allow server operators and single-player users to adjust these parameters. You can modify durability values, crafting recipes, and repair costs via the config menu.
For public servers, adjusting these settings can tailor the early-game experience to your community's preferences. A harder difficulty setting might reduce durability to force faster progression to iron, while a relaxed community server could increase longevity to support extensive building projects. Changes made to the configuration files apply to new worlds by default, though existing saves may require manual updates to the serverconfig folder. Always create a backup of your world data before altering configuration files to ensure data integrity.
